Campus parking
Parking on campus is extremely limited, so if you don't absolutely, positively need a car to get around, save money and parking headaches and leave your car behind. Employees and students who choose not to drive may be eligible for up to $300
through Stanford's Clean Air Cash Rewards Program.

Parking for commuting faculty, staff and students
Stanford affiliation is required to purchase long-term permits (30+ days) and "A" and "C" daily scratcher permits - they are not available to the general public. They are issued only to:
- Stanford University and Medical Center faculty, students and staff
- employees of organizations housed on campus; and
- persons sponsored by a University department or on-campus organization (such as temporary employees, volunteers and visiting scholars).

Eligibility
When purchasing your commuter permit, we'll need to see one of the following:
- your Stanford ID
- a Sponsorship form from your department administrator (available from your campus department and the Forms/Applications page).
Parking for resident students
Resident students can buy "Resident" permits for their designated house or dorm areas. However, incoming freshmen may not bring a car to campus.

Stanford Hospital & Clinics parking
Patient/visitor and some commuter parking at Stanford Hospital & Clinics and Lucile Packard Children's Hospital is administered by the hospitals, not by the university's P&TS office. Please visit the parking information pages on the Stanford Health Care or Stanford Children's Health websites for information on hospital parking. Hospital employees, please refer to our commuter parking page.
